Skin Biopsies and Excisions
Skin biopsies and excisions are key services offered at our clinic. A skin biopsy helps doctors check for cancer by removing a small piece of skin. The sample is then tested in a lab for any signs of melanoma, basal cell carcinoma, or squamous cell carcinoma.
Excisional biopsy means cutting out the entire growth along with some healthy tissue. This helps to ensure no cancer cells remain. Cryotherapy and photodynamic therapy may also be used if needed.
Results from these tests usually come back within 48 hours, helping you understand your health quickly.

What Does a Full Body Skin Check Include?
A full body skin check involves examining every inch of your skin, from your scalp to your toes. The process includes assessing moles, freckles, and any unusual lesions. Our specialists use advanced techniques to locate irregularities that might not be visible to the naked eye.
What to Wear for Your Appointment
For your appointment at Skin Cancer Hub, we recommend wearing comfortable, loose-fitting clothing that’s easy to remove. Avoid make-up, heavy lotions, or nail polish, as they can obscure the visibility of spots. This allows our team to perform a detailed and effective check.

Spotting the Signs of Skin Cancer
Common signs of skin cancer include moles that change shape, size, or colour, and lesions that bleed or don’t heal. If you notice these signs, see a doctor immediately. Our skin cancer clinic can identify and treat these issues before they progress.
How Early Detection Helps
Early detection significantly improves treatment outcomes. Catching a lesion or mole early means treatment can be less invasive, and the chances of a full recovery are much higher. Regular visits to Skin Cancer Hub can give you peace of mind and safeguard your health.
